A Sticky Eye
A discharge from the eye can be bothersome and often is present upon waking in the morning . This condition is frequently caused by a build-up of debris and too much sebum near the margin. While mild crusting is often benign , persistent or intense cases may indicate an underlying inflammation like conjunctivitis , a condition affecting the eyelids, or a pimple on the eyelid . Contributing factors encompass poor lid hygiene, sensitivity to allergens , and lack of tear production more info . Care typically involves delicately washing the eyelid with a warm compress and may require prescription ointments if an inflammation is identified. Consult a healthcare professional for a definitive diagnosis and personalized advice .
